The linear regulator controllers have been designed so that they
remain active even when the switching controller is in UVLO mode
to ensure that the output voltages of the linear regulators will track
the 3.3 V supply as required by Intel design specifications. By
diode ORing the VCC input of the IC to the 5 VSB and 12 V
supplies as shown in Figure 3, the switching output will be disabled
in standby mode, but the linear regulators will begin conducting
once VCC rises above about 1 V. During start-up the linear out-
puts will track the 3.3 V supply up until they reach their respective
regulation points, regardless of the state of the 12 V supply. Once
the 12 V supply has exceeded the 5 VSB supply by more than a
diode drop, the controller IC will track the 12 V supply. Once the
12 V supply has risen above the UVLO value, the switching regula-
tor will begin its start-up sequence.

APPLICATION INFORMATION
Specifications for a Design Example
The design parameters for a typical 750 MHz Pentium III appli-
cation (shown in Figure 3) are as follows:
Input Voltage: (VIN) = 5 V
Auxiliary Input: (VCC) = 12 V
Output Voltage (VVID) = 1.7 V
Maximum Output Current (IO(MAX)) = 15 A
Minimum Output Current (IO(MIN)) = 1 A
Static tolerance of the supply voltage for the processor core
(VO) = +40 mV (–80 mV) = 120 mV
Transient tolerance (for less than 2 µs) of the supply voltage
for the processor core when the load changes between the
minimum and maximum values with a di/dt of 20 A/µs
(VO(TRANSIENT)) = +80 mV (–130 mV) = 210 mV
Input current di/dt when the load changes between the mini-
mum and maximum values < 0.1 A/µs.
The above requirements correspond to Intel’s published power
supply requirements based on VRM 8.4 guidelines.
